Please find below the response to your Freedom of Information request

 

“Can you provide a list of derelict, empty and abandoned buildings /
houses
both private and council please and if know how long these buildings have
not
been occupied for.”

 

Response

 

We are unable to disclose details of empty properties under the Freedom of
Information Act as we believe that Section 31 (1) (a) (Law Enforcement)
exemption is engaged and that the public interest in withholding the
information outweighs the public interest in providing the information.
